What are the most popular songs for Trap/Future Bass musician Grimecraft?
Grimecraft is a musician from San Francisco who has created a lot of well-known tunes in the electronic, trap, and future bass genres. "Malie City (From Pokemon Sun & Moon) [feat. Wishlyst]", "Sweden (Minecraft Remix)", and "Animal Crossing - One for Kapp'n" are a few of his best songs.
"Malie City (From Pokemon Sun & Moon) [feat. Wishlyst]", one of his most well-known songs, has a dreamy, ethereal melody and soft vocals from Wishlyst. Another well-liked song is "Sweden (Minecraft Remix)," which combines elements from the vintage video game with an uplifting and catchy techno sound. Another fan favorite, "Animal Crossing - One for Kapp'n" has a catchy beat and fun sounds that are drawn from the well-known video game.
"Stickerbrush Symphony (Donkey Kong Country Remix)," "Missing U," and "Chemical Plant (From Sonic the Hedgehog 2) - Remix" are some of Grimecraft's other well-liked songs. Fans of both video games and electronic music have shown a special fondness for his remixes of vintage video game music.

Which are the most important collaborations with other musicians for Trap/Future Bass musician Grimecraft?
Grimecraft, a San Francisco-based electronic, trap, and future bass musician, has worked with a wide range of musicians to create his music. The partnerships with Wishlyst, Smooth McGroove, and CG5 are noteworthy.
The collaboration with Wishlyst is audible in the ethereal, dreamlike nature of the vocals in the song "Malie City (From "Pokemon Sun & Moon") [feat. Wishlyst]. The song combines pop and electronic elements to provide an upbeat yet soothing vibe. A track that is both distinctive and memorable is the product of the partnership between Grimecraft and Wishlyst.
The tracks "Sweden (Minecraft Remix)" and "Stickerbrush Symphony (Donkey Kong Country Remix)" from Grimecraft's partnership with Smooth McGroove stand out for their usage of video game soundtracks as source material. Smooth McGroove's vocal prowess complements the electronic and trap/future bass parts of Grimecraft's music, which frequently take the shape of acapella interpretations of vintage video game tracks.
Last but not least, Grimecraft's collaboration with CG5 on "Littleroot Town [From 'Pokemon Ruby & Sapphire']" exemplifies his capacity to combine electronic, trap, and future bass components with the nostalgia of vintage video game soundtracks. The vocals of CG5 give the song a humorous, upbeat character that distinguishes it from other tracks on Grimecraft's catalog.
